CurrentStack
#ai#agents#edge#security#platform

CloudflareのAIエージェント向けサンドボックス高速化を、実運用セキュリティ成果に変える方法

Cloudflareが提示した「AIエージェント向けサンドボックスの大幅な高速化」は、単なる高速化ニュースではありません。運用現場にとって本質的なのは、“分離を標準化できる” という点です。これまで多くのチームは、セキュリティを強くすると応答遅延が悪化し、遅延を優先すると分離を弱める、というトレードオフに悩まされてきました。

しかし起動コストが下がると、1タスク1サンドボックスの設計が現実的になります。これは攻撃面積を縮小し、万一の侵害時にも影響範囲を最小化できるため、ガバナンス上の価値が非常に大きいです。

参考文脈: Cloudflare Blog(AIエージェント向けサンドボックス関連)https://blog.cloudflare.com/

なぜ今このテーマが重要か

2026年時点のエージェント開発は、PoC段階から業務実装段階へ移行しています。エージェントは以下を実行し始めています。

  • 社内APIの呼び出し
  • 取引・請求・在庫情報へのアクセス
  • コード生成と実行
  • 顧客データを含むドキュメント処理

この状況で「便利だから広い権限を与える」は最悪手です。高速サンドボックスは、利便性を落とさず最小権限を徹底するための土台になります。

推奨アーキテクチャ

実務で安定しやすい分割は次の5層です。

  1. Gateway Worker: 認証・テナント識別・リクエスト分類
  2. Policy Engine: リスク区分ごとに許可能力を決定
  3. Sandbox Runtime: 能力を絞った実行環境で処理
  4. Audit Pipeline: 実行メタデータを改ざん困難な形で保存
  5. Result Guard: 出力の機密漏えい検査と整形

特に重要なのは、ポリシー判断と実行環境を分離することです。これにより、監査・法務対応・事故調査が一気にやりやすくなります。

高速化がセキュリティを強化する理由

起動が遅い環境では、チームは次第に「使い回し前提」の長寿命ランタイムへ寄り、結果として権限肥大を招きます。高速起動が可能になると、次が可能です。

  • 1実行単位ごとに環境を使い捨てる
  • 例外運用(暫定的な広権限)を減らす
  • テナント境界を強固に保つ
  • 不審操作の切り離しを迅速化する

つまり、パフォーマンス改善はUXだけでなく、安全設計を選びやすくする経営的な余裕 を生みます。

失敗しやすい権限設計を避ける

事故の主因は高度な脆弱性より、雑な権限設計です。以下のように能力を明示し、曖昧語を禁止してください。

  • net.read.public
  • net.read.approved-domains
  • storage.read.session
  • storage.write.ephemeral
  • tool.invoke.billing-readonly

「インターネットアクセス許可」や「社内API全許可」は監査不能です。能力名そのものを監査対象アーティファクトにしてください。

運用で追うべきSLO

API応答時間だけでは不十分です。最低でも次を週次で確認します。

  • サンドボックス起動 p95 / p99
  • ポリシー拒否率(プロファイル別)
  • タイムアウト率(ツール別)
  • 強制終了件数
  • 未分類能力要求件数

数値が取れない領域は、必ず運用品質が劣化します。

インシデント前提での準備項目

本番で自律処理を増やす前に、以下を満たすべきです。

  • 30日分のポリシー判定を再現できるか
  • 5分以内に能力カテゴリを全停止できるか
  • テナント単位の隔離を即時実行できるか
  • 外向き通信の制限をリアルタイム反映できるか

1つでも未達なら、まずは範囲を限定して段階導入する方が安全です。

90日導入ロードマップ

  • 1〜30日: 現行フロー計測、リスク階層化
  • 31〜60日: 高リスク経路から厳格プロファイルへ移行
  • 61〜90日: CIでポリシー契約テストを必須化

最終目標は「自律化率の高さ」ではなく、失敗を制御できる自律化 です。

まとめ

Cloudflareの高速化は、エージェント基盤を実運用へ進める強力な追い風です。ただし、速度だけでは安全になりません。最小権限、監査可能性、即時ロールバックを同時に設計したチームだけが、開発速度と信頼性を両立できます。

おすすめ記事